One of the primary domains where 2-ethynylnaphthalene demonstrates significant impact is in the pharmaceutical industry. As a key chemical intermediate, it plays a crucial role in the synthesis of various active pharmaceutical ingredients (APIs). The ethynyl group can be readily manipulated through sophisticated organic chemistry reactions to build complex molecular structures that form the basis of new therapeutic agents. The consistent search for cost-effective and high-quality 2-ethynylnaphthalene reflects its indispensable nature in drug discovery and development pipelines.

Beyond pharmaceuticals, 2-ethynylnaphthalene has carved out a vital niche in materials science. Its unique electronic properties, stemming from the conjugated pi-electron system of the naphthalene ring and the ethynyl substituent, make it an attractive candidate for advanced materials. Researchers are increasingly utilizing this naphthalene ethynyl derivative in the development of organic electronics, such as organic light-emitting diodes (OLEDs) and organic photovoltaics (OPVs). The ability to precisely tune material characteristics through chemical modification makes 2-ethynylnaphthalene an invaluable tool for creating next-generation electronic components.

Furthermore, the compound's reactivity makes it a versatile starting point for creating specialized polymers and functional molecules. Its role as an organic synthesis building block extends to academic research, where it is employed to explore novel reaction pathways and synthesize complex molecular architectures for various studies. Whether it's used in developing fluorescent probes or as a component in supramolecular chemistry, the versatility of 2-ethynylnaphthalene is continually being unveiled.
